A pair of late Victorian/early Edwardian trompe l' oeil pine dummy boards
each figure carved and painted in Tudor attire, the young woman holding a fan in her right hand, her young companion with his left hand resting on his sword hilt and holding a fruit in his right hand, with chamfered edge and triangular back support, some restorations and replacements, the taller 100,5cm high
(2)
Provenance
Sold: Stephan Welz & Co, The Kynnersley-Browne auction, Johannesburg, 12 October 1988, lot 316
Sold: Stephan Welz & Co, Property of the Estate Late Mr LN Woolff, 7th February 2006, lot 347
